How Turbochargers Work and Their Advantages
Turbocharges use the energy from exhaust gases to spin a turbine, which then compresses the intake air before it enters the engine. This significantly increases the horsepower without drawing power directly from the engine itself.
One of the biggest advantages of a turbocharger is its efficiency. A turbocharger doesn’t place any additional strain on the crankshaft because it relies on exhaust gases rather than being mechanically driven. Because of this, turbochargers improve fuel efficiency compared to superchargers. Many high-performance brands, including Porsche and McLaren, use turbocharging technology to maintain an optimal balance between power and efficiency.
Turbochargers also substantially boost performance, allowing smaller engines to produce power levels comparable to much larger naturally aspirated units. This is why you can commonly find turbocharged engines in modern exotic cars, as manufacturers want to maximize power output while adhering to stricter fuel economy and emissions regulations.
However, nothing is perfect—turbochargers also have their downsides. The most common drawback is turbo lag, a delay in power delivery caused by the time it takes for exhaust gases to build up and spool the turbo. While modern twin-scroll and variable geometry turbochargers have reduced this issue, it’s still relevant for those who prefer immediate throttle response.
Another consideration is heat management. Turbocharged engines generate a lot of heat, requiring sophisticated cooling systems to keep the vehicle running at top performance. How Superchargers Work and Their Benefits
Unlike turbochargers, the engine’s crankshaft mechanically drives a supercharger via a belt system. Because they don’t rely on exhaust gases, superchargers provide instantaneous power delivery without the delay associated with turbo lag. This makes them popular with enthusiasts who prioritize throttle response and immediate acceleration.
Superchargers come in several types, including roots-style, twin-screw, and centrifugal superchargers. Each has its own method of compressing air, but they all share the common advantage of delivering consistent power across the rev range. This is particularly ideal for track driving and high-speed runs, where predictable and linear acceleration is crucial.
Another key benefit is reliability. Since superchargers operate independently of the exhaust system, they generate less heat than turbochargers. This can reduce stress on engine components and simplify long-term maintenance.
However, superchargers aren’t as efficient as turbochargers because they use power from the engine to function. This results in a slight decrease in fuel efficiency, as the engine redirects part of its energy to drive the compressor. Additionally, while a supercharger provides a consistent boost, it may not match the peak horsepower gains achieved by an aggressively tuned turbocharger setup.

Which One Is Right for Your Exotic Car?
The choice between a turbocharger and a supercharger ultimately depends on your driving preferences and how you intend to drive your car.
If you want maximum power with better efficiency, a turbocharger is the way to go. The ability to generate significant horsepower gains without sacrificing fuel economy makes it ideal for both street and track driving.
However, if instant throttle response and linear power delivery are more important to you, then a supercharger is the better option.
For example, if you own a McLaren 720S, the twin-turbocharged V8 delivers explosive power and efficiency, making it a perfect example of why turbo technology dominates modern supercars. On the other hand, models like the Dodge Challenger SRT Hellcat utilize a supercharged V8 to provide instant power without delay, making it a favorite among muscle car enthusiasts.
Remember to also consider maintenance and serviceability. Turbochargers require advanced heat management solutions and more frequent oil changes due to their reliance on exhaust gases. Superchargers are mechanically simpler but can place additional strain on the engine’s internals, requiring reinforced components for durability.
